The art and architecture of each culture reflects its history, values, and beliefs. Ancient structures such as the Great Pyramids of Egypt or the Parthenon in Athens demonstrate that these civilizations had advanced engineering skills and were capable of creating monuments that still stand today. Other examples include the intricate stone carvings found in Mayan temples, the colorful tiles used in Islamic architecture, and the modern skyscrapers of cities like New York or Tokyo.

Each culture has its own unique style of art and architecture. For example, Chinese architecture is characterized by symmetrical buildings with curved rooflines, while Gothic architecture is characterized by pointed arches and spires. Islamic art is known for its intricate geometric patterns, while Native American art is known for its bright colors and symbols. The materials used to create these works of art and architecture also vary from culture to culture. Ancient civilizations often used stone or wood to construct their monuments, while modern architects use steel, concrete, and glass.

The materials used can also reflect a culture’s values; for example, Islamic architecture often uses gold or marble to symbolize wealth and power. The ancient Egyptians are renowned for their impressive architectural feats, from the colossal pyramids to the vast temple complexes at Luxor.

Ancient Egyptian art is also renowned for its grandeur and beauty, particularly in its sculpture and reliefs which celebrated the gods, pharaohs, and important events. Similarly, the ancient Greeks are credited with pioneering the development of sculpture, painting, and architecture. Classical Greek structures such as the Parthenon on the Acropolis in Athens is a testament to their skill and ingenuity. The ancient Chinese also left behind an impressive legacy of art and architecture.

From the Great Wall to the terracotta warriors, there are many examples of ancient Chinese art and architecture that have stood the test of time. Traditional Chinese painting and calligraphy are also highly regarded for their intricate details and vivid colors.
